The president of the Iowa and Nebraska conference of NAACP branches has resigned over the group's national board resolution to support gay marriage.
Rev. Keith Ratliff Sr. resigned from the National Association for the Advancement of Colored People and as president of the state conference.
Ratliff, of Maple Street Missionary Baptist Church in Des Moines, has long opposed gay-marriage. He said he was struggling with the group's endorsement made during a leadership retreat in Miami last month and was uncertain about his future with the NAACP.
The Iowa/Nebraska Conference includes Ames, Burlington, Cedar Rapids, Davenport, Des Moines and Sioux City in Iowa and Nebraska
branches in Lincoln and Omaha.
